In 2006, there were 2,573 computer viruses and other security incident. During the next 7 years, the number of incidents increas

ed by about 92% each year.
Mathematics
1 answer:
EleoNora [17]3 years ago
7 0

Answer:

Total number of virus after 7yrs= 247484.7 virus

Step-by-step explanation:

Total number of virus after 7yrs = 2573(1+0.92)⁷ = 247484.7 virus

Marlina received her salary on Friday. She spent one-half of her salary on rent and then spent $338 on her electric and water bi
Alenkinab [10]

Answer:

$654

Step-by-step explanation:

Let the amount of money Marlina's received for her salary be x.

We know that she spent 1/2 of her salary on rent and then $338 on her electric and water bill. So, after this, she will have:

x-\frac{1}{2}x-338

Left of her salary.

Next, she spent one half of what was left. So, it will be one-half of the equation. Therefore, she will have spent:

x-\frac{1}{2}x-338-\frac{1}{2}(x-\frac{1}{2}x-338)

Finally, she spent $56 for gas. So, we will subtract 56:

x-\frac{1}{2}x-338-\frac{1}{2}(x-\frac{1}{2}x-338)-56

And we know that after all of the expenses, she will have $102 left. Therefore:

x-\frac{1}{2}x-338-\frac{1}{2}(x-\frac{1}{2}x-338)-56=102

We want to know how much Marlina spent on rent. So, let's find her salary x first.

First, let's distribute the 1/2:

x-\frac{1}{2}x-338-\frac{1}{2}x+\frac{1}{4}x+169-56=102

Combine like terms:

(x-\frac{1}{2}x-\frac{1}{2}x+\frac{1}{4}x)+(-338+169-56)=102

Evaluate:

\frac{1}{4}x-225=102

Add 225 to both sides:

\frac{1}{4}x=327

Multiply both sides by 4:

x=\$ 1308

Therefore, Marlina received a total of $1308 for her salary.

We know that she spent half of her salary on rent. Therefore, the amount she spent on rent is:

r=\frac{1}{2}(1308)=\$ 654

And we're done!
